Output 621a370552dc0db0e8e904c7515d0625f496a63f96a20afd219c37d842ee44db:0

value
12500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a75b2abf3ea5fdd336e2e42c310d5878d6a7a2ac OP_EQUAL
address
3GwuyyM4zsPQGyU2aydqax6aKFXAFSTtd7
transaction
621a370552dc0db0e8e904c7515d0625f496a63f96a20afd219c37d842ee44db
confirmations
199032
spent
true